How Can Chimps Cry Actually Works
Key Insights
Chimpanzees lack tear ducts that produce watery tears like humans, but they show emotional emotion through subtle, observable behaviors. When distressed, overwhelmed, or experiencing grief, chimps may display facial expressions—such as lip smacking, increased brow tension, or ear positioning—that resemble shedding “tears” in form. These visible cues are not chemical like human crying but serve as social signals that communicate emotional states to group members.
Research confirms chimps express stress, love, frustration, and loss using body language and vocalizations. These expressions play vital roles in social bonding, conflict resolution, and caretaking—especially among family groups. While not tears, these behaviors warrant attention as markers of deep emotional lives.
Common Questions About Can Chimps Cry
Q: Do chimpanzees cry like humans?
No, chimps do not produce tears in a liquid form. Their emotional distress appears through facial cues and body language, serving similar functional roles in communication.
